We are currently seeking a Lead Account Manager join our Honeywell Building Automation team in our Auckland office. This role focus is to continuously identify new sales opportunities and focus on providing consultative support by building value propositions for the customer, manage and build customer contacts and be the local point for relationship strategies, sales plans, proposal strategies, and contract negotiations, for pursuits in play.

KEY EXPERIENCE & CAPABILITIES: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Marketing, Engineering or other business-related field
  • 3-6 years of business to business selling experience
  • Building Services industry experience would be highly advantageous
  • Familiarity with industry regulatory requirements and future mandates
  • In-depth knowledge of Honeywell and competitor platforms, products and technologies is advantageous
  • Experience in technical writing and preparation of proposals
  • Demonstrated ability to develop and foster strong customer relationships
  • Ability to communicate effectively across language and cultural barriers

Responsibilities
  • Drive demand and deliver revenue AOP
  • Customer engagement with product specialist to create and close opportunities
  • Attends sales calls to recommend products, provide technical support and identify help needed to close sales
  • Work directly in the field one on one with Product specialists/front line sellers to increase product and regulation knowledge
  • Review pipeline, monitor trends, add coaching notes and work zone managers
  • Provide detailed forecast to signal the LOB demand to supply chains
  • Engage in two-way communication with offering managers and engineering to pass on industry intel, solve issues and provide feedback
